WebAug 13, 2024 · Ratio: Fresh pasta dough is always made with 3 parts flour and 2 parts egg, the ratio is 3 : 2. One large-size egg weighs about 2 ounces; one cup of flour weighs about 5 ounces. Use one large-size egg for each full serving you want to make, to that add 1 ½ the egg’s weight in flour. Some folks like to add a little splash of water to the yolks to help everything come together more easily. brandillhole • 2 yr. ago cityfit silowniaWebFeb 7, 2024 · The Muffin Ratio: 2:2:1:1, flour to liquid to fat to eggs. The magic ratio for muffins in 2:2:1:1. This means 2 parts flour to 2 parts liquid to 1 part fat to 1 part eggs. The really important part is remembering to use the same unit of weight for each part!
